Western Digital Corporation (WDC)
Number of days of payables
Jun 30, 2025 | Jun 30, 2024 | Jun 30, 2023 | Jun 30, 2022 | Jun 30, 2021 | ||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Payables turnover | 4.60 | 5.83 | 6.58 | 5.81 | 5.32 | |
Number of days of payables | days | 79.29 | 62.56 | 55.46 | 62.78 | 68.64 |
June 30, 2025 calculation
Number of days of payables = 365 ÷ Payables turnover
= 365 ÷ 4.60
= 79.29
The number of days of payables for Western Digital Corporation demonstrates notable variability over the analyzed period from June 30, 2021, to June 30, 2025. As of June 30, 2021, the company’s payables period was approximately 68.64 days, indicating the average duration it took to settle accounts payable obligations. By June 30, 2022, this period decreased to approximately 62.78 days, reflecting a shortening of the payable cycle. The trend continued into June 30, 2023, with the payables period further diminishing to roughly 55.46 days, suggesting an improvement in the company's cash management or supplier payment terms.
However, between June 30, 2024, and June 30, 2025, there was a reversal in this trend. The payables period increased to about 62.56 days in mid-2024, signaling a lengthening of the time taken to pay suppliers. This upward movement persisted and intensified by June 30, 2025, reaching approximately 79.29 days, which is significantly higher than the prior years’ figures.
Overall, the data indicates a pattern where Western Digital initially reduced its accounts payable cycle over the first two years, implying potentially more efficient management of payables or a strategic effort to accelerate payments. Nonetheless, in the subsequent years, there was a notable increase, culminating in a substantially longer payables period in 2025, which could suggest extended payment terms, changes in supplier relationships, or shifts in the company's liquidity and cash flow management strategies.
